What is the Least Common Multiple of 98400 and 98408?
Least common multiple or lowest common denominator (lcd) can be calculated in two way; with the LCM formula calculation of greatest common factor (GCF), or multiplying the prime factors with the highest exponent factor.
Least common multiple (LCM) of 98400 and 98408 is 1210418400.
LCM(98400,98408) = 1210418400
Least Common Multiple of 98400 and 98408 with GCF Formula
The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 98400 and 98408, than apply into the LCM equation.
GCF(98400,98408) = 8
LCM(98400,98408) = ( 98400 × 98408) / 8
LCM(98400,98408) = 9683347200 / 8
LCM(98400,98408) = 1210418400
